Iceland's Bell: A Masterpiece of Sculptural Art

Nestled in the heart of Akureyri, Iceland's Bell stands as a remarkable testament to the nation's rich artistic culture. This striking sculpture is not only visually captivating but also deeply symbolic, representing the harmonious relationship between nature and human creativity. Crafted with precision and thoughtfulness, the sculpture invites visitors to ponder its significance while enjoying the surrounding landscape. The serene atmosphere of Akureyri enhances the experience, making it a perfect spot for reflection and appreciation of art.
